January 2nd Speaks - a non-holiday poem

January 2nd Speaks
by
Greg Pincus

Yesterday came and folks burst into song,
Yet nobody's cheering when I come along.
I don't get confetti. I get no parade.
A movie about me has never been made.
I've tried bringing sun, bringing snow, bringing rain.
It just doesn't matter: I don't rate champagne.
In some ways I'm lucky - at least I'm a date...
But always the second's a frustrating fate.

A Message from Saturday the 14th - a non-holiday poem

A Message from Saturday the 14th
by
Greg Pincus

You see? You’re still here.
There was nothing to fear.
The 13th is a terrible tease.

And me? I’ve been waiting,
Anticipating...
Relaxed as a bird on the breeze.

I know I could mention
I get no attention,
Yet truly, it doesn’t annoy me.

And so I just say,
“I’m a fabulous day.
Don’t waste me, my friends. Enjoy me!”


I was gonna dazzle y'all with a fancy word for the fear of the number 14 instead of the standard triskaidekaphobia comment... but it turns out there isn't a real term. Man, the 13th really does get all the attention. So unfair....
